💸 Moving Costs in Sarasota in 2025: More Than You Think
On the surface, selling your house and buying bigger sounds simple. But in today’s market, the cost of moving is steep.
Here’s what you're really paying:
🏡 Home prices in Sarasota are up 20–30% since 2020
💰 Expect to pay $700K–$1M+ for upgraded square footage in top neighborhoods
📝 Realtor commissions: 6% of your home sale ($30K+ on average)
🛻 Moving costs: $3K–$10K
🏦 Mortgage closing costs: 2–5% of new home price
📦 Temporary housing, storage, and moving logistics
🔧 Renovations and updates in the new home too
Average cost to “move up” in Sarasota: $80,000–$200,000
And you’ll still likely need to remodel your next home anyway.
🧱 What Does a Room Addition Cost in Sarasota in 2025?
Instead of relocating, many homeowners are staying put—and adding space.
Here’s a breakdown of 2025 addition costs:
🛏️ Bedroom or den addition (200–400 sq ft):
$60K–$125K
🛁 Bedroom + en suite bath (300–500 sq ft):
$90K–$175K
🏠 Full primary suite addition (500–700 sq ft):
$140K–$250K
🍽️ Kitchen + living space extension (400–600 sq ft):
$120K–$225K
🧱 In-law suite or guest house (600–1,000+ sq ft):
$175K–$350K+
These additions boost resale value and can increase equity faster than a move.

⏱️ Timeline: How Long Does an Addition Take?
Room additions don’t happen overnight—but they’re much faster than selling and moving.
Here’s a realistic 2025 timeline:
🧠 Design & planning: 3–6 weeks
📝 Permitting: 3–8 weeks
🔨 Construction: 3–6 months
🧼 Final finishes and inspections: 2–3 weeks
Total time: 4 to 8 months
Compare that to:
⏳ Selling, buying, and moving: 6–12 months
💼 Multiple closings, listings, showings, and negotiations

✅ When Moving Does Make Sense
We’re pro-addition—but we’re also honest.
You may want to consider moving if:
🏚️ Your current home has major structural or foundation issues
🌊 You need to leave a flood zone
🧳 You’re relocating for work or retirement
🚫 HOA rules restrict additions
💰 You have significant equity and can profitably upsize elsewhere

🛠️ Real Talk: What’s the ROI of Room Additions in Sarasota?
On average, Sarasota homeowners recoup 65%–90% of the cost of a smart home addition—depending on type and quality.
Best ROI Additions in 2025:
🛏️ Primary suites
🛁 Bathrooms
🏠 Open-concept living spaces
🍽️ Kitchen expansions
🧱 In-law units (especially with separate entrances)
Many additions increase equity faster than property appreciation.
